KNR Constructions rises on bagging project worth Rs 482.04 crore

KNR Constructions has bagged second Hybrid Annuity Project (HAM) with bid project cost of Rs 482.04 crore from National Highways Authority of India (NHAI) for the work of two Laning with Paved Shoulder of Meensurutti (Km 98.433) to Chidambaram (Km 129.965) Section of NH-227 under Bhartmala Pariyojana, Phase I (Residual Project under NHDP) in the state of Tamil Nadu with a concession period of 17 years including construction period of 2 years from the appointed date.

KNR Construction is a multi domain infrastructure project development company providing (EPC) engineering, procurement and construction services across various fast growing sectors namely roads & highways, irrigation and urban water infrastructure management.
